- [ ] Step 7: Archive cold storage buckets (Glacierline tier). Confirm both ceremony witnesses are present, verify bucket manifests match the Oxbow ledger, then seal the archive key shares. Plugin authors may observe but not handle shares. Once sealed, the archive index itself is encrypted and can only be reopened with the passphrase below.

vault phrase of badup-hahig = tamael-aldael-kelmir-istael-fenok-istwyn-tamius-jorath-oliion

## Runbook: PortionWise restart

PortionWise is the recipe-scaling calculator behind the Kettleworth cooking apps. On OOM or stuck workers, drain via the Harborline balancer, restart the pod, and confirm the health probe within 60 seconds. No persistent state; conversions are recomputed on demand. Before restarting, verify the running instance matches the expected configuration values listed below.

deployment values, fafog-fawip:
[jorox]
team = fendor
access_code = ac_bb00ea
host = jorox.qorveltech.internal
port = 9200
owner = istdor.aldeth
peer = julvan.orvexlabs.internal

Q: A resident is locked out of their Sudsport laundry locker and the kiosk is unresponsive — what now? A: On-call should restart the kiosk agent from the Drumwell console, then re-issue the locker code. If the console itself rejects your session, use the break-glass recovery account. Its passphrase is listed immediately below for reference during incidents.

vault phrase of yajof-hahip = norir-tammir-beldor-wenir

## Snapshot Testing Environments — Willowmere UI

Snapshot tests for Willowmere components run in three environments: local, the shared Quillstone staging cluster, and the nightly verification ring. Support staff should note that snapshot diffs in staging can lag local results by one deploy cycle, which often explains 'phantom' failures reported by users. The staging snapshot runner starts with the configuration values listed here.

deployment values, kajep-kageg:
[praix]
host = praix.paliqcorp.corp
user = praix_svc
database = praix_prod